About 17 Kingston Avenue
17 Kingston Avenue is a four-bedroom semi-detached house in Blackpool (FY4 2QB). It has a recorded floor area of 145 m² (around 1561 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(July 2017) shows an E (score 44),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 71), a 2-band jump. Period features are noted in the property record.
At 145 m² the property is well over the postcode median (85 m² across 19 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 79% of similar EPCs). 9 years since the last transfer (October 2017). Today's modelled estimate of £239,000 is 47.5% above the 2017 sale price.
